14 LOCATION OF POSITION 120 East Baltimore Street Baltimore, Maryland 21202 Main Purpose of Job This position reports to the supervisor of the Estimates Processing Team and serves as the lead worker of the team. This team processes a high volume of requests from members who are considering retirement and want an estimate of their monthly retirement allowances. This position assists the supervisor in all aspects of effectively and efficiently processing these requests through the staff assigned to this team. POSITION DUTIES Assign and review estimate request and retirement application calculation worksheets in accordance with established procedures to minimize backlogs and to ensure timely processing; Provide guidance and training to new and existing staff in the preparation and calculation of estimates requests and retirement application calculation worksheets in n accordance with established procedures to minimize backlogs and to ensure timely processing; Assist the section supervisor in the preparation and modification of procedures; Special projects and other duties as assigned by the Retirement Processing Manager, Deputy Director, or Director.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S Education: Possession of a Bachelor's degree from an accredited four-year college or university. Experience: Two years experience in administrative or professional work. Notes: 1. Candidates may substitute additional experience in administrative staff or professional work on a year-for-year basis for the required education. 2. Candidates may substitute additional graduate level education at an accredited college or university at the rate of 30 semester credit hours for each year of the required experience. 3. Candidates may substitute US Armed Forces military service experience as a commissioned officer involving staff work that included regular use of independent judgment and analysis in applying and interpreting complex administrative plans, policies, rules or regulations or analysis of operational programs or procedures with recommendations for improvement on a year-for-year basis for the required education and experience. DESIRED OR P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S Preferred Qualifications: One year of experience with Microsoft Suite of software applications: Excel, Outlook, and Word. Two years of experience working and/or checking estimates and/or finals.
